无法将'spring.ora-datasource'下的属性绑定到javax.sql.DataSource的错误通常是由于配置文件中的属性与实际的数据源配置不匹配导致的。要解决这个问题,可以按照以下步骤进行排查和修复:
- 检查配置文件:首先,确保配置文件中的属性名称正确无误。检查'spring.ora-datasource'下的属性是否正确拼写,并且与实际数据源配置中的属性名称一致。
- 检查数据源配置:确认实际的数据源配置是否正确。检查数据库连接信息、用户名、密码等是否正确配置,并且确保数据库服务正常运行。
- 检查依赖库:确保项目的依赖库中包含了正确的数据库驱动程序。根据实际使用的数据库类型,引入相应的数据库驱动程序,并将其添加到项目的依赖中。
- 检查数据源配置方式:根据具体的框架和配置方式,确认数据源的配置方式是否正确。例如,在Spring框架中,可以使用XML配置文件或注解方式配置数据源,确保选择了正确的配置方式。
- 检查权限:如果使用的是远程数据库服务,确保数据库服务器允许远程连接,并且使用的用户名和密码具有足够的权限访问数据库。
如果以上步骤都没有解决问题,可以尝试以下方法:
- 清除缓存:有时候配置文件的更改可能没有及时生效,可以尝试清除项目的缓存,重新构建和部署项目。
- 重启服务:如果是在运行中的服务中出现问题,可以尝试重启服务,以确保配置的更新生效。
如果以上方法都无法解决问题,可以查阅相关文档或向开发社区寻求帮助,以获取更具体的解决方案。
关于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体品牌商,建议您访问腾讯云官方网站,查找与数据库、数据存储、云计算等相关的产品和服务,以获取更详细的信息和推荐。